Key Issues Behind the Protests

Several key issues have emerged as the primary points of contention for the anti-Musk protesters. These issues focus on both Musk’s actions as a business leader and his broader public persona.

1. Labor Practices and Treatment of Employees

One of the most significant criticisms leveled against Musk is the treatment of employees within his companies. Critics argue that Tesla has a poor record when it comes to worker rights and safety, citing incidents involving hazardous working conditions, long hours, and low wages in the company’s factories.

Protesters target Tesla showrooms in US over Elon Musk's government  cost-cutting | Tesla | The Guardian

Workers at Tesla’s Fremont factory in California, for example, have been vocal about issues such as long hours with little overtime pay, workplace injuries, and pressure to meet high production quotas. This has led to allegations of labor exploitation in Musk’s factories, which have fueled many of the protests.

3. Free Speech and the Twitter Takeover

Musk’s controversial acquisition of Twitter, now known as X, has been a focal point for critics who claim that Musk’s handling of the platform has threatened free speech and the integrity of online discourse.

Elon Musk blames George Soros, Democratic donors for protests against Tesla  | World News - Business Standard

Since Musk’s takeover, there have been numerous changes to the platform, including the unbanning of controversial figures, a shift toward subscription-based models, and a relaxation of content moderation policies. Critics argue that these changes have opened the door to the spread of misinformation and hate speech on the platform, sparking concerns about the role Musk plays in influencing global political discourse. The protests will also address these concerns, with demonstrators rallying against the concentration of power Musk holds over digital communication platforms.
